About the role

  • HRIS Analyst supporting Workday processes and configuration for Northwest Bank. Responsible for requirements gathering, testing, and enhancing HR processes within Workday.

Responsibilities

  • Supports Workday processes and configuration
  • Leading requirements gathering, regression testing, and configuring business process changes
  • Data analysis, driving process improvements, and analyzing system configurations
  • Proactively recommend process improvements to further automate and enhance both the manager and employee experiences within Workday
  • Develop and maintain custom reports, dashboards, and data feeds
  • Point of contact for production support for Workday questions or issue management

Requirements

  • Bachelor’s Degree or Workday experience
  • At least 3+ years of Workday experience, data analytics, or related experience
  • Bachelor’s Degree in Information Technology, Data Analytics, Business Analysis, Accounting, Statistics, Business Administration, Economics, or Finance (Preferred)
  • Workday Pro Certification (Preferred)
  • 5+ years of experience working with Microsoft Office (Preferred)
